From d38c2a09fcc9acf693bdf5880d16f9ec5fe27656 Mon Sep 17 00:00:00 2001 From: Net <93821485+somnetsak123@users.noreply.github.com> Date: Tue, 11 Jun 2024 15:31:00 +0700 Subject: [PATCH] =?UTF-8?q?fix:=20=E0=B9=81=E0=B8=81=E0=B9=89=20=20i18n=20?= =?UTF-8?q?=20=E0=B8=AB=E0=B8=B2=20key=20=20=E0=B9=84=E0=B8=A1=E0=B9=88?= =?UTF-8?q?=E0=B9=80=E0=B8=88=E0=B8=AD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/pages/03_customer-management/MainPage.vue | 33 +++++++------------ 1 file changed, 12 insertions(+), 21 deletions(-) diff --git a/src/pages/03_customer-management/MainPage.vue b/src/pages/03_customer-management/MainPage.vue index f095f971..f5936344 100644 --- a/src/pages/03_customer-management/MainPage.vue +++ b/src/pages/03_customer-management/MainPage.vue @@ -235,12 +235,12 @@ const listEmployee = ref(); const itemCard = [ { icon: 'mdi:office-building', - text: 'CORP', + text: 'customerLegalEntity', color: 'var(--purple-8)', }, { icon: 'heroicons:user-solid', - text: 'PERS', + text: 'customerNaturalPerson', color: 'var(--green-9)', }, ]; @@ -278,7 +278,11 @@ const employeeTab = [ }, ]; -const fieldCustomer = ref(['all', 'CORP', 'PERS']); +const fieldCustomer = ref([ + 'all', + 'customerLegalEntity', + 'customerNaturalPerson', +]); const dialogCustomerType = ref(false); const dialogInputForm = ref(false); @@ -649,15 +653,17 @@ watch(currentPageCustomer, async () => { watch(fieldSelectedCustomer, async () => { let resultList; + console.log(fieldSelectedCustomer.value.value); + if (fieldSelectedCustomer.value.value === 'all') { resultList = await fetchList({ includeBranch: true }); } - if (fieldSelectedCustomer.value.value === 'CORP') { + if (fieldSelectedCustomer.value.value === 'customerLegalEntity') { resultList = await fetchList({ includeBranch: true, customerType: 'CORP' }); } - if (fieldSelectedCustomer.value.value === 'PERS') { + if (fieldSelectedCustomer.value.value === 'customerNaturalPerson') { resultList = await fetchList({ includeBranch: true, customerType: 'PERS' }); } @@ -806,22 +812,7 @@ watch(fieldSelectedCustomer, async () => { style="min-height: 250px" >